Can't detect I2C displays with Arduino Nano

All cables tested and work:

SCL - A5
SDA - A4
VCC - 5V
GND - GND

I'm using an Arduino Nano board and an I2C display - I've tried everything to get it to work and I'm now convinced it's a hardware fault. Using the Arduino I2C address scanner, it is unable to find a device, even though it is wired correctly  (I've checked multiple times).
